General Information

General Information Comment Organism
drug target the enzyme (BVR-A) is a potential therapeutic target to prevent brain insulin resistance in Alzheimer disease Mus musculus
malfunction impairment of biliverdin reductase-A (BVR-A) is an early event leading to brain insulin resistance in Alzheimer disease. Cells lacking the enzyme (BVR-A) develop insulin resistance if treated with insulin and can be recovered from insulin resistance only if treated with a BVR-A-mimetic peptide Mus musculus
